Title: **Innovations of Hideya Yokouchi: A Pioneer in Liquid Ejecting Apparatus**
Introduction
Hideya Yokouchi, based in Okaya, Japan, is a notable inventor renowned for his contributions to the development of liquid ejecting apparatus. With a remarkable portfolio consisting of 35 patents, Yokouchi has made significant strides in enhancing the functionality and efficiency of liquid ejection technology.
Latest Patents
Among his recent patents is a maintenance method for liquid ejecting apparatus, which details a unique design comprising a liquid ejection head that expels liquid through nozzles. The apparatus includes a first passage linked to the liquid ejection head, supplying the necessary liquid, and a second passage that forms a circulation passage in conjunction with the first. Central to this innovation is a liquid driving unit situated within the circulation passage, which not only facilitates the movement of liquid but also maintains the meniscus inside the nozzles by alternating between two flow rates. This mechanism ensures the sustenance of optimal liquid dynamics for efficient ejection.
